Artur Arutyunov, Head of Aviation Projects at the Aluminium Association, took part in SPAF 2024. The forum is organised and conducted by the Russian United Systems of Modern Transportation Technologies company, a domestic manufacturer of ground support equipment for the aviation. The event was attended by the heads of airlines, representatives of their IT departments, production and dispatching services, flight control centres, passenger transportation services, cargo terminals, and partner companies.
Artur Arutyunov spoke about aviation palletising equipment, including aluminium aviation pallets and LD3 and LD3-45W containers.
Aviation palletising equipment includes special aviation containers designed for the air transportation of baggage, cargo and mail
The aviation container and pallet have been fully developed in Russia. They are manufactured under Russian and international standards and are suitable for carriage by various types of aircraft. The introduction of automation in production helped reduce the cost of the final products. This has allowed the products to successfully compete with those by foreign suppliers. Previously, containers and pallets were not produced in Russia, but rather imported from China and Europe. Aviation palletising equipment comprises highly sought-after products in the market. Every year, the demand for them increases due to the deterioration of the existing containers and pallets. Today, the domestic market is estimated at 12,930 units. According to experts, until 2030, the demand of Russian airlines will keep growing by 1,175 units annually.
The average service life of aviation palletising equipment is 6 years, and the warranty life is 5 years
The products are made of 7xxx-series extrahigh tensile aluminium alloy. The load capacity for the LD3 (DKH) container is 1,588 kg with a mass of 75 kg; for the LD3 (DKE) container, it is 1,225 kg with a mass of 66 kg.
Aeroflot and Red Wings have already successfully tested the containers of both types. This year's plans include completing the certification of products with the relevant agencies.
Aviation pallets are pallets designed for the transportation of luggage and cargo in a wide-body, as well as in some types of narrow-body aircraft. A pallet weighs 91 kg, and its maximum cargo load can exceed 6,800 kg.
